About Sharpsburg, Ohio

Sharpsburg unfolds across a gentle swell of Mercer County land, a place where the horizon stretches out in broad, cultivated strokes. It lies 9.3 miles south-east of Noble, IN (from Noble, IN: bearing 139°T), and is situated 8.8 miles south-south-west of Coldwater.
